Controversial Actor Kamaal Rashid Khan Arrested by Mumbai Police Over Firing Incident
Mumbai. Controversial actor and film critic Kamaal Rashid Khan (KRK) was arrested by the Mumbai Police on Saturday. He was taken into custody in connection with an incident where shots were fired at a residential building in Oshiwara, Mumbai.
According to the police, KRK admitted to firing two rounds from his licensed weapon at Nalanda Society in Oshiwara on January 18. A case has been registered against him under various sections of the Indian Penal Code and the Arms Act.
During the investigation of the incident, the police recovered two spent casings from the society premises. One of these casings was found on the second floor, and the other on the fourth floor. Interestingly, one of these flats belongs to writer-director Neeraj Kumar Mishra, and the other belongs to model Prateek Vaidya.
Although initially no concrete evidence was found from CCTV footage, the police summoned KRK to the Oshiwara police station for questioning after forensic tests indicated the shots were fired from KRK's bungalow nearby. The motive behind KRK firing the shots has not yet been revealed.
KRK is always in the spotlight in Bollywood due to his controversial remarks. He, who calls himself a film critic, has made sharp comments against veteran stars like Salman Khan, Shah Rukh Khan, and Ajay Devgn.
Salman Khan had even filed a defamation suit against him. KRK, who appeared in the lead role in his self-produced film 'Deshdrohi' in 2008, played a supporting role in the 2014 hit film 'Ek Villain'.
